Warning Signs You Need Standing Water Extraction
Don’t ignore these warning signs – they can lead to bigger problems and more extensive damage. Our team is here to help you identify and address these issues before they become major headaches.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ors can be a sign of standing water or moisture in your property. If you notice musty smells that won’t go away, it’s time to call our team for standing water extraction.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age or standing water. If you notice this issue, it’s essential to address it quickly to prevent further damage.
Water Stains or Discoloration
Water stains or discoloration on walls, ceilings, or floors can be a sign of standing water or water damage. Our team is here to help you identify and address these issues.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age or standing water. If you notice this issue, it’s time to call our team for standing water extraction.
Unusual Sounds or Leaks
Unusual sounds or leaks in your property can be a sign of standing water or water damage. Our team is here to help you identify and address these issues before they become major problems.

Standing Water Extraction Cost In Wyomissing, PA
The cost of standing water extraction in Wyomissing, PA can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area. Our team provides free estimates and works with your insurance company to ensure a smooth and hassle-free claims process.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Extraction and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ed |
| Disinfection and sanitizing |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of surfaces affected, and equipment needed |
| Final inspection and touch-ups |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area and complexity of repairs |
| Emergency service (after hours or weekends) | $200 – $1,000 | Time of day and day of the week |
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ment and the specifics of your situation. We offer free estimates and work with your insurance company to ensure a smooth and hassle-free claims process.
